I have the following set up to copy data from one workbook, search for that
data in another workbook (I'm not replacing the data, but moving over 2 cells and continuing...) I'd like for it to search for the data without requiring my to paste into Find/Replace. Is this possible? Dim FindString As String Dim Rng As Range Application.CutCopyMode = False Selection.Copy Windows("Updated Consumer Acc List 2005_02_15.xls").Activate FindString = InputBox("Enter a Search value") Cells.Find(What:=FindString, After:=ActiveCell, LookIn:= _ xlFormulas, LookAt:=xlPart, SearchOrder:=xlByRows, SearchDirection:= _ xlNext, MatchCase:=False).Activate |
